After a lengthy debate about academic rigor, equity and vendor process, the board approved RFP #26-3 to provide spring/summer/winter expanded-learning services (Kidchella spring-family event and vendor partnerships). District staff said academic lessons are designed and delivered by district certificated staff; the contract passed 3–2.

The Palm Springs Unified School District board voted 3—— to 2 on Feb. 24 to award RFP #26-3 for expanded-learning spring/summer/winter camp services, a contract that includes the district's spring-family event (Kidchella) and vendor-provided experiential lessons.
